Where this album fits
- Career context
- In 1985, Stephanie Mills released her self-titled album during a significant phase in her career following her successful stint on Broadway in 'The Wiz'. This album marked her first release after the commercially successful 'Stephanie Mills' (1983) and aimed to solidify her presence in the mainstream R&B scene. At this point, Mills was transitioning from theater to a more defined solo artistry in music.
